如何搭建服务器的工程
-
搭建服务器的工程可以分为以下几个步骤:
-
硬件选择和购买:首先要选择合适的服务器硬件,包括服务器主机、硬盘、内存等。根据需要选择合适的配置。购买时可以多家对比,选择性价比高的产品。
-
操作系统选择和安装:根据服务器用途选择合适的操作系统,如Windows Server、Linux等。安装操作系统时,需要注意选择适应服务器硬件的版本,并按照提示进行安装。
-
网络设置和连接:设置服务器的网络参数,包括IP地址、子网掩码、网关等。将服务器与局域网连接或通过路由器进行连接,确保网络正常通畅。
-
防火墙配置:为了保护服务器的安全,需要正确配置防火墙。根据需要限制和允许的端口和IP地址,设置进入和离开服务器的流量规则。
-
数据库安装和配置:根据需要安装数据库软件,如MySQL、Oracle等。安装后,进行基本的配置,设置数据库的用户名和密码,并创建所需的数据库。
-
Web服务器设置:如果需要搭建网站或提供Web服务,需要安装和配置Web服务器,如Apache、Nginx等。设置网站目录、虚拟主机等,保证网站正常运行。
-
安全性设置:为了保护服务器的安全,需要进行一些安全性设置,如开启SSH访问、设置密码复杂度策略、配置登录失败限制等。
-
监控和日志管理:设置服务器的监控和日志管理,以便及时发现和解决问题。可以使用监控工具实时监控服务器的运行状态,设置日志管理策略,方便查找和分析服务器日志。
-
数据备份和恢复:定期备份服务器的重要数据,以防止数据丢失。可以使用备份软件或脚本,将数据备份到外部存储设备,保证数据的安全性。
-
安全更新和维护:定期更新服务器软件和补丁,以修复安全漏洞和提高性能。同时进行维护工作,如清理无用的日志、优化数据库等,保证服务器的正常运行。
总之,搭建服务器的工程需要有一定的技术知识和经验。以上是搭建服务器的基本步骤,需要根据实际情况进行调整和扩展。在搭建过程中,有问题时可以查阅相关文档或寻求专业人士的帮助。
1年前 -
-
搭建服务器的工程是一个复杂的过程,它需要充分的计划、资源调配和技术实施。以下是搭建服务器工程的一般步骤和关键点:
-
确定服务器类型和规模:首先,你需要确定你想要构建的服务器类型和规模。服务器类型可以是Web服务器、数据库服务器、文件服务器等。服务器规模可以根据所需的处理能力、存储需求和网络流量来确定。
-
选择合适的硬件:根据你确定的服务器类型和规模,选择适合的硬件设备。包括服务器机箱、主板、CPU、内存、硬盘等。
-
选择适当的操作系统:根据服务器的用途和你所熟悉的操作系统,选择合适的操作系统。常见的选择包括Linux、Windows Server等。
-
设置网络和安全:配置服务器的网络设置,包括IP地址、子网掩码、默认网关等。同时,也要考虑服务器的安全性,配置防火墙和其他安全措施。
-
安装和配置软件:根据服务器的用途和操作系统选择适当的软件。例如,如果你构建的是Web服务器,可以选择安装Apache或Nginx作为Web服务器软件。安装完毕后,还需要进行相应的配置,包括设定服务的启动选项、端口设置、权限配置等。
-
数据备份和灾备方案:为了确保服务器的可靠性和数据的安全,需要制定相应的数据备份和灾备方案。定期备份数据,并将备份数据存储在安全的地方。
-
进行性能优化和监控:为了保证服务器的性能和稳定性,需要进行性能优化和监控。可以使用性能监控工具来监视服务器性能,并对服务器进行优化,如调整内核参数、优化数据库性能等。
除了以上步骤,还有一些其他的关键点需要注意,如:
- 确保服务器的硬件兼容性:在选择硬件设备时,要确保它们与所选操作系统的兼容性,以避免驱动程序或兼容性问题。
- 资源规划和管理:在服务器规划中,要考虑到服务器的资源需求和管理,包括处理能力、存储需求和网络流量等。
- 考虑可扩展性:在服务器搭建过程中,应考虑到未来的扩展需求,以便在需要时能够方便地扩展服务器的能力和容量。
- 安全性和权限控制:为了确保服务器的安全性,需要采取相应的安全措施,如配置防火墙、应用安全补丁、用户权限控制等。
- 定期维护和更新:服务器搭建完成后,需要进行定期的维护和更新,以确保服务器的正常运行和安全性。
总之,搭建服务器的工程需要充分的计划和技术实施。通过以上步骤和关键点的考虑,可以帮助您成功搭建服务器工程。
1年前 -
-
搭建服务器的工程主要包括以下几个步骤:选择服务器硬件、安装操作系统、配置网络、设置安全规则、安装服务软件、优化性能等。下面我将详细介绍每个步骤的具体操作流程。
一、选择服务器硬件
- 确定服务器用途:根据自己的需求确定服务器的用途,如Web服务器、数据库服务器、游戏服务器等。
- 决定服务器规模:根据预估的访问量和数据处理需求确定服务器的规模,包括 CPU、内存、硬盘容量等。
- 选择服务器供应商:根据需求选择合适的服务器供应商,比较价格、品牌、售后服务等因素进行选购。
二、安装操作系统
- 下载操作系统镜像:根据服务器硬件的架构(如x86、ARM)和需求(如服务器版、桌面版)下载相应的操作系统镜像文件。
- 创建启动盘:将下载的操作系统镜像写入USB或DVD光盘,制作成可启动的安装介质。
- 启动服务器:将启动介质插入服务器,启动服务器,并按照提示进入操作系统安装界面。
- 安装操作系统:按照操作系统安装向导进行安装,设置主机名、网络配置、用户账号等。
三、配置网络
- 配置IP地址:根据局域网或公网环境的网络规划,为服务器设置合适的IP地址、子网掩码、网关。
- 配置DNS解析:根据需求配置DNS服务器地址,用于域名解析。
- 配置端口转发/端口映射:如果服务器处于局域网后面,需要针对需要对外服务的端口进行端口转发或端口映射,将外部请求转发到服务器内部。
四、设置安全规则
- 安装防火墙软件:根据操作系统的要求,安装相应的防火墙软件,如iptables、firewalld等。
- 配置防火墙规则:根据需求和服务器用途,设置合适的防火墙规则,限制不必要的访问,并保护服务器免受恶意攻击。
- 启用安全加固措施:设置安全策略,如禁止root用户登录、启用SSH密钥登录等,以增加服务器的安全性。
五、安装服务软件
- 安装Web服务器:如Apache、Nginx等,用于承载网站、提供HTTP服务。
- 安装数据库服务器:如MySQL、PostgreSQL等,用于存储和管理数据。
- 安装应用服务器:如Tomcat、Node.js等,用于运行应用程序。
- 安装其他必要的服务软件:如FTP服务器、邮件服务器、缓存服务器等,根据需求进行安装。
六、优化性能
- 调整服务器参数:根据服务器硬件和应用需求,对操作系统参数进行优化,如内核参数、网络参数等。
- 使用缓存技术:使用缓存服务器、CDN等技术,提高网站或应用的响应速度。
- 进行负载均衡:配置负载均衡器,实现多台服务器间的请求分发,提高整体性能和稳定性。
- 配置监控和报警:设置监控系统,实时监视服务器的状态和性能,并配置报警规则,及时响应问题。
总结:搭建服务器的工程包括选择服务器硬件、安装操作系统、配置网络、设置安全规则、安装服务软件和优化性能。通过以上步骤的操作,可以建立起一个具备稳定性、性能优越的服务器工程。
1年前